For Romeos, there are 2 types of titanium finishes, but only 1 plasma finish.

The first gen titanium finish (commonly called the bone finish) have the matte light grey finish. The second gen titanium finish have the shiny look very similar to the plasma finish, but there is a slight difference. The plasma has a slight gold/yellowish shine on the finish compared to the second gen titanium finish which is more silver like. The second gen shiny titanium finished started at around the x60000 serial numbers. Then they switched them to a A serial afterwards. The same thing happened to the plasmas which also got a A serial at the end eventually (though the finishes remained the same for those)

I have no idea which one is more rare.

I like the first gen ti more, but you need to be careful with the finishes on them as they are prone to blackening. The second gen ti finish does not have that problem.
 
Nowadays it’s very hard to find untouched pairs of R1 1st gen Ti (bone)
